What Are Weft Hair Extensions?

Weft hair extensions consist of a strip of hair sewn or glued together at the top to form a weft. This weft can be made of human hair or high-quality synthetic hair, depending on the desired look and budget. Wefts can be applied to natural hair using different methods such as sewing, clipping, or gluing. The extensions are designed to blend seamlessly with natural hair, providing additional length and volume. They are available in various textures, colors, and lengths, making them suitable for a wide range of hair types and styling preferences.

Types of Weft Hair Extensions

Understanding the different types of weft hair extensions is crucial for choosing the right one for your needs

  • Clip-In WeftsTemporary wefts that can be clipped in and removed daily. They are convenient for occasional use.
  • Glue-In WeftsAttached using hair adhesive, providing a more permanent option compared to clip-ins, but they require careful application.
  • Machine-Made vs Hand-Tied WeftsMachine-made wefts are thicker and more uniform, whereas hand-tied wefts are lighter and provide a more natural look.

Benefits of Weft Hair Extensions

Weft hair extensions are favored by many because of their unique advantages. They can offer a natural appearance and versatility for styling.

1. Adds Volume and Length

One of the primary benefits of weft hair extensions is their ability to add significant volume and length to your hair. This is especially helpful for individuals with thin or short hair who want a fuller look. Multiple wefts can be layered to achieve the desired thickness and length, giving a natural and seamless appearance.

2. Versatile Styling Options

Wefts allow for various styling options, including braids, curls, and straight styles. Since they are often made of high-quality human hair, they can be styled with heat tools, colored, and treated like your natural hair. This flexibility makes them ideal for special occasions, photoshoots, or daily wear.

3. Long-Lasting

Sewn-in and properly maintained weft extensions can last for several months, making them a cost-effective solution for those who want a long-term hair transformation. With regular care, they maintain their appearance and integrity, providing ongoing beauty benefits.

4. Natural Look

Wefts are designed to blend seamlessly with your natural hair, creating a smooth and natural appearance. When installed correctly, it becomes nearly impossible to distinguish between your hair and the extensions. This natural integration is one of the key reasons people choose weft extensions over other types.

Potential Drawbacks of Weft Hair Extensions

While weft hair extensions offer numerous benefits, they also come with potential drawbacks that should be considered before use.

1. Installation Time

Sewn-in and glue-in wefts can take several hours to install, depending on the number of wefts and the method used. This requires patience and possibly a professional stylist to ensure proper application.

2. Maintenance Requirements

Weft hair extensions require proper care to maintain their quality. Regular washing, conditioning, and gentle handling are essential to prevent tangling and matting. Neglecting maintenance can reduce their lifespan and affect appearance.

3. Risk of Hair Damage

If wefts are applied incorrectly or left in too long, they may cause tension on natural hair, leading to breakage or hair loss. It’s important to ensure proper application and removal techniques are used to protect the scalp and natural hair.

4. Cost Considerations

High-quality human hair wefts can be expensive, and professional installation adds to the overall cost. While they are long-lasting, it’s important to weigh the benefits against the investment required.

Caring for Weft Hair Extensions

Proper care is crucial to maintain the appearance and lifespan of weft hair extensions. Here are some tips

  • Use sulfate-free shampoos and conditioners to prevent damage to the extensions.
  • Detangle gently with a wide-tooth comb to avoid pulling on the wefts.
  • Avoid excessive heat and chemical treatments to extend the life of the extensions.
  • Schedule regular maintenance appointments with a stylist if using semi-permanent wefts.
  • Protect the hair while sleeping by braiding or using a silk pillowcase to reduce friction.
